Saradha: Madan Mitra admitted to SSKM, court rejects his bail plea

| | Feb 12, 2015, at 03:09 am
Kolkata, Feb 11 (IBNS): Trinamool Congress (TMC) leader and West Bengal sports and transport minister Madan Mitra was admitted to the state owned Seth Sukhlal Karnani Memorial (SSKM) hospital in Kolkata on Wednesday afternoon.
On Wednesday noon, he complained of chest pain and breathing trouble after which Alipore jail authorities sent him immediately to the SSKM hospital.
 
Madan Mitra's wife, elder son and elder daughter-in-law came to SSKM to meet him.
 
According to the hospital sources, the TMC leader is admitted in cabin-20 of Woodburn Block in SSKM and he is stable now.
 
Meanwhile, the Alipore court rejected his bail plea on Wednesday.
 
Mitra's lawyers plead for their client's bail. However,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I)'s lawyers opposed of this bail plea. 
 
After listening to both sides, judge Samaresh Prasad Choudhury rejected the bail plea.
 
On the other side, the Enforcement Directorate (ED) on Wednesday interrogated the accountant of Saradha group Amrin Ara, two businessmen-Sanjay Basu and Ramlal-in connection with Saradha scam for few hours at CGO Complex in Salt Lake.
